Output c624b3c686eecf0c89bc1a9cf26efb4cfb38fa81d8d3b8e542158c3e23039e8d:50

value
229165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52068259644f19de64541038828a369017cce079 OP_EQUAL
address
39Aj8YEfTDp5dVMq722cmTxBaU8G418mJV
transaction
c624b3c686eecf0c89bc1a9cf26efb4cfb38fa81d8d3b8e542158c3e23039e8d
confirmations
195016
spent
true